**New Orleans – September 27, 2022** – Autodesk, Inc. (NASDAQ: ADSK) is kicking off its annual design and innovation event, Autodesk University (AU) 2022, in person for the first time since 2019. The conference, held from September 27 to 29 in New Orleans, brings together thousands of professionals from architecture, engineering, construction (AEC), product design and manufacturing (D&M), and media and entertainment (M&E). This year’s event focuses on how digital transformation can help organizations overcome today’s biggest challenges—like supply chain disruptions, labor shortages, and remote collaboration.
Attendees will hear from industry leaders, including representatives from the City of New Orleans, Harvard Business School, British Antarctic Survey, Amazon Studios, and BBi Autosport. These experts will share real-world strategies for using technology to connect people, processes, and data more effectively.

This year, Autodesk is launching three new industry clouds: **Autodesk Forma**, **Autodesk Flow**, and **Autodesk Fusion**, all built on the Autodesk Platform. These platforms are designed to streamline workflows across industries and improve collaboration.
- **Autodesk Forma** is tailored for AEC professionals, unifying BIM workflows to support planning, design, and building operations.
- **Autodesk Flow** supports M&E by connecting production workflows from concept to delivery, starting with asset management.
- **Autodesk Fusion** targets D&M, linking product development from design to manufacturing. It includes Fusion 360, Autodesk Fusion 360 Manage with Upchain, and Prodsmart.
“Fusion 360 exemplifies the power of connected environments that span the entire project lifecycle,†said Raji Arasu, Autodesk CTO. “As we expand each industry cloud, a centralized information model will ensure every team member has the right data at the right time.â€
Behind these innovations lies **Autodesk Platform Services**, the evolution of Forge. This platform provides APIs and services that allow customers to customize solutions, integrate tools, and build new workflows.
